- Who wins the Data Duel between Bolivia and Guatemala?
- Guatemala wins the Data Duel 7-3 across the 12 indicators compared. The comparison covers GDP, population, life expectancy, CO₂ emissions, and 8 more indicators sourced from the World Bank.
- How do Bolivia and Guatemala compare on GDP?
- Bolivia has a GDP of $49.7 billion, while Guatemala has $113.2 billion. Guatemala leads on this indicator.
- How do Bolivia and Guatemala compare on GDP per Capita?
- Bolivia has a GDP per Capita of $4,001.211, while Guatemala has $6,150.026. Guatemala leads on this indicator.
